Job description

Description:

Participate as a team member in the technical development of schematic, design development, construction documents, specifications, and construction administration for institutional and commercial building projects.



Duties Include:

  • Electrical engineering of power and lighting systems for institutional, retail and commercial building projects.
  • Prepare calculations and well-coordinated, technically sound construction documents that are cost effective, clear, efficient, and constructible in a friendly work environment.
  • Communicate and coordinate with architects, owners, other engineering disciplines, vendors, building officials, other consultants, etc. throughout the design phases of the building project.
  • Perform engineering calculations including energy, load, photometrics, voltage drop, etc.
  • Must meet client schedules and internal design and construction administration time budgets.
  • Office construction administration including review of shop drawings, respond to RFI’s, and coordinate with contractors, design team, building officials, owner, etc. through the construction phase of the building project.
  • Able to travel nationally for pre-design site visits, design meetings, construction phase site observations, etc. and prepare detailed technical narrative reports
Requirements:
  • Bachelor of Science degree in Electrical Engineering required.
  • Must possess excellent oral and written communication skills.
  • Efficient in Microsoft Word and Excel.
  • Familiar with AutoCAD and Revit.
  • FE/EIT a plus.
  • Capable of attending and engaging in meetings with clients, owners, contractors, etc. in a positive and productive manner.
  • Possess a good work ethic and be efficient in job duties.
  • Willing to work extra hours above 40 hours a week when necessary to meet project deadlines and client demands.
